Dangerous operation of a motor vehicle charges, Thursday Island

Police have charged a man after a car crashed into residence on Thursday Island this morning, Queensland Police say.

Officers were called to an address on Poruma Street at 9.40am following reports a car had rolled down a driveway into the veranda of the property and damaged a water mains pipe.

It will be alleged that two men were involved in an altercation, and one of the men disengaged the park break on a stationary car causing it to roll down the driveway.

No one was physically injured as a result of the incident, and the damage and structural integrity of the property will be assessed.

A 22-year-old man has been charged with one count each of dangerous operation of a motor vehicle and adversely affected by an intoxicating substance and unlawful use of a motor vehicle and three counts of wilful damage.

He is due to appear in the Thursday Island Magistrates Court on January 17.
